首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

我该如何建模这些关系?

建模这些关系可以采用关系型数据库的概念,使用表格来表示不同实体之间的关系。以下是一个简单的建模示例:

  1. 创建实体表:根据提供的问答内容,可以创建多个实体表,如用户表、项目表、技术表等。每个表包含相应的属性列,如用户表可以包含姓名、年龄、职业等属性列。
  2. 建立关系:根据实体之间的关系,可以创建关系表来表示它们之间的连接。例如,用户表和项目表之间可能存在多对多的关系,可以创建一个用户-项目关系表来记录用户参与的项目。
  3. 定义主键和外键:在每个表中,需要定义主键来唯一标识每个实体,通常使用自增长的整数作为主键。同时,根据实体之间的关系,可以在关系表中定义外键来建立关联。
  4. 设计索引:为了提高查询效率,可以在表中设计索引,以加快数据检索的速度。通常可以根据经常被查询的列来创建索引。
  5. 规范化数据:为了避免数据冗余和更新异常,可以对数据进行规范化处理。通过将数据拆分成多个表,并通过主键和外键建立关联,可以减少数据冗余并确保数据的一致性。
  6. 使用腾讯云相关产品:根据具体需求,可以选择腾讯云提供的相关产品来支持建模和管理数据。例如,可以使用腾讯云数据库MySQL版来存储和管理数据,使用腾讯云云服务器来进行服务器运维,使用腾讯云人工智能服务来进行人工智能相关的开发等。

请注意,以上仅为一个简单的建模示例,实际建模过程可能会更加复杂,需要根据具体需求和情况进行调整和优化。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券